Meeting with the Director of Culture, Jamaica

Jamaica currently has one ministry for information, culture, youth and sports. The Director of Culture within that ministry is a man called Sydney Bartley. He is Jamaica's representative in the CIC. I am happy to say that he has always been open to meeting with me and he is very much one of the youth's greatest allies in the Americas.
Even though he was extremely busy planning a national celebration for our Olympic team this weekend, he took the time yesterday to meet with Maria, Gregory and myself. His insights were very useful for me, especially because he explained to us why we did not get the kind of feedback that we anticipated at the Royal York Hotel on September 19, 2008. That meeting was really just a preparatory meeting before the ministerial meeting in Barbados this November.
All we have to do is complete our official report for Barbados and ensure that it is presented effectively to the ministers there and we can expect a more definitive engagement. I feel more confident now that we will eventually achieve a meaningful dialogue with our governments.
Since Mr. Bartley did not have a lot of time yesterday, he asked us to see him again next week Friday, October 10, 2008. He intends to support Maria and Gregory in their local initiatives as Igniters and I am sure he will be very accomodating to our mission.
